The 2025 MLB regular season is down to its final week, and the playoff picture is becoming clearer, but plenty of drama remains! Several teams have already clinched their spots, while others are fighting tooth and nail for a chance to compete for the World Series.
Who's Clinched a Spot?
So far, the Milwaukee Brewers (at least NL Wild Card), Philadelphia Phillies (NL East Division), Chicago Cubs (NL Wild Card), Los Angeles Dodgers (at least NL Wild Card) and Toronto Blue Jays (at least AL Wild Card) have secured their places in the postseason.
Key Division Battles to Watch
- NL West: The Dodgers are trying to hold off the Padres to clinch the division crown.
- AL West: A fierce battle between the Mariners and Astros. The loser likely falls into a Wild Card spot.
- AL Central: The Tigers are barely clinging to their lead, with the Guardians surging.
- AL East: The Blue Jays have a slim lead over the Yankees.
Wild Card Races Intensify
In the National League, the Padres and Mets currently hold Wild Card spots, but the Giants, Reds, and Diamondbacks are making a strong push. Over in the American League, the Yankees and Red Sox are in Wild Card position, but the Guardians are charging hard.
Magic Numbers to Watch
Here are some key magic numbers for teams trying to clinch their division or a playoff berth:
- Brewers: 1 to win NL Central (vs. Cubs)
- Dodgers: 3 to win NL West (vs. Padres)
- Blue Jays: 4 to win AL East (vs. Yankees)
- Mariners: 5 to win AL West (vs. Astros)
- Tigers: 6 to win AL Central (vs. Guardians)
- Padres: 3 to clinch at least NL wild card (vs. Reds)
- Yankees: 4 to clinch at least AL wild card (vs. Guardians)
- Mariners: 4 to clinch at least AL wild card (vs. Guardians)
- Red Sox: 5 to clinch at least AL wild card (vs. Guardians)
- Tigers: 6 to clinch at least AL wild card (vs. Guardians)
- Astros: 7 to clinch at least AL wild card (vs. Guardians)
- Mets: 7 to clinch at least NL wild card (vs. Reds)
